"The new models in the UV segment have created a lot of excitement in the market. Also the sentiment is positive due to better rains and coming of the 7th Pay Commission. All these factors put together are responsible for the off take which is happening," SIAM Deputy Secretary General Sugato Sen was quoted saying.
Talking of the rise in overall PV sales, UVs remained the main driving force here, with a rise of 41.85% to reach 64,105 units, as compared to last July’s 45,191 units.
India’s biggest carmaker Maruti Suzuki has seen a rise in the sales of domestic cars by 2.21% in July to 93,634 units from 91,602 units a year ago. The sales of its UV jumped 151% and reached 17,382 units from 6,916 units.
